  • Michèle was an answer to my prayers for our first birth! I knew I wanted a midwife after trying out several OB/GYNs I finally found her. I was so grateful that she was a veteran, military spouse and supported the military community by accepting Tricare. She has vast knowledge of a woman's body and worked in the NICU so she knew all about what was happening with our baby after it was born. She was also the first practitioner that included my husband in the whole process completely. The doctors had either ignored him or shushed him but Michele made sure to talk to him as well as me - she respected his role as my partner and birth coach. I cannot stress enough how much I appreciated Michele's warm encouragement and her respect for my wishes. I highly recommended her services for any mama & family!

    Kimberly S.
